diff options
author | Doug Newgard | 2017-07-03 10:56:32 -0500 |
---|---|---|
committer | Doug Newgard | 2017-07-03 21:35:02 -0500 |
commit | 52fad004dce39e84236c11e7d3d7387d6d93e2fe (patch) | |
tree | 57bc570e6aafd16adc98808a46bd55524ebea2a8 | |
parent | 6036ef9549d7b6a6f12dca78c8d960155f02a1da (diff) | |
download | aur-52fad004dce39e84236c11e7d3d7387d6d93e2fe.tar.gz |
Switch to Qt5
-rw-r--r-- | .SRCINFO | 8 | ||||
-rw-r--r-- | .gitignore | 4 | ||||
-rw-r--r-- | PKGBUILD | 18 |
3 files changed, 21 insertions, 9 deletions
@@ -1,15 +1,19 @@ pkgbase = qwtpolar pkgdesc = Qwt library that contains classes for displaying values on a polar coordinate system pkgver = 1.1.1 - pkgrel = 1 + pkgrel = 2 url = http://qwtpolar.sourceforge.net/ arch = i686 arch = x86_64 license = custom:qwt depends = gcc-libs depends = glibc - depends = qt4 + depends = qt5-base + depends = qt5-svg depends = qwt + provides = qwtpolar-qt5=1.1.1 + conflicts = qwtpolar-qt5 + replaces = qwtpolar-qt5 source = http://sourceforge.net/projects/qwtpolar/files/qwtpolar/1.1.1/qwtpolar-1.1.1.tar.bz2 sha1sums = 38edf5220c971eef0e88fcc6db7c718e6198ccac diff --git a/.gitignore b/.gitignore new file mode 100644 index 000000000000..71a9d16c2b38 --- /dev/null +++ b/.gitignore @@ -0,0 +1,4 @@ +*~ +*/ +*.tar.* +*.log @@ -5,12 +5,15 @@ pkgname=qwtpolar pkgver=1.1.1 -pkgrel=1 +pkgrel=2 pkgdesc='Qwt library that contains classes for displaying values on a polar coordinate system' arch=('i686' 'x86_64') url='http://qwtpolar.sourceforge.net/' license=('custom:qwt') -depends=('gcc-libs' 'glibc' 'qt4' 'qwt') +depends=('gcc-libs' 'glibc' 'qt5-base' 'qt5-svg' 'qwt') +conflicts=('qwtpolar-qt5') +provides=("qwtpolar-qt5=$pkgver") +replaces=('qwtpolar-qt5') source=("http://sourceforge.net/projects/qwtpolar/files/$pkgname/$pkgver/$pkgname-$pkgver.tar.bz2") sha1sums=('38edf5220c971eef0e88fcc6db7c718e6198ccac') @@ -19,9 +22,9 @@ prepare() { sed -e '/^\s*QWT_POLAR_INSTALL_PREFIX/ s|=.*|= /usr|' \ -e '/^QWT_POLAR_INSTALL_DOCS/ s|/doc|/share/doc/qwtpolar|' \ - -e '/^QWT_POLAR_INSTALL_HEADERS/ s|/include|/include/qwt|' \ - -e '/^QWT_POLAR_INSTALL_FEATURES/ s|/features|/share/qt4/mkspecs/features|' \ - -e '/^QWT_POLAR_INSTALL_PLUGINS/ s|/plugins|/lib/qt4/plugins|' \ + -e '/^QWT_POLAR_INSTALL_HEADERS/ s|/include|&/qwt|' \ + -e '/^QWT_POLAR_INSTALL_PLUGINS/ s|/plugins/designer|/lib/qt&|' \ + -e '/^QWT_POLAR_INSTALL_FEATURES/ s|/features|/lib/qt/mkspecs&|' \ -e '/QwtPolarExamples/ s/^/# /' \ -i qwtpolarconfig.pri } @@ -29,7 +32,8 @@ prepare() { build() { cd $pkgname-$pkgver - qmake-qt4 qwtpolar.pro + export QMAKEFEATURES="/usr/share/qt5/mkspecs/features/" + qmake-qt5 qwtpolar.pro make } @@ -38,7 +42,7 @@ package() { make INSTALL_ROOT="$pkgdir" install - install -Dm644 COPYING "$pkgdir/usr/share/licenses/$pkgname/COPYING" + install -Dm644 COPYING -t "$pkgdir/usr/share/licenses/$pkgname/" mv "$pkgdir/usr/share/doc/qwtpolar/man/" "$pkgdir/usr/share/" rm "$pkgdir/usr/share/man/man3/qwtlicense.3" } |